Background
After the towel products are dyed and dehydrated, the towel products can be subjected to a cutting, sewing and packaging process after being dried, 2-3 dryers are required to be arranged in the drying process for improving the efficiency and the quality, in the prior art, the towel products between two adjacent machines are in direct transmission connection, and due to the small difference of the speed between the two adjacent machines, the surface tension of goods can be increased in the operation process, so that the quality of the products is reduced.

The first mounting plate 1 is mounted at the top of the cloth hopper 5 through screws, the second mounting plate 3 is connected with the support 4 through an adjusting mechanism, the adjusting mechanism comprises a first connecting plate 16 and a first fixing block 9, the first fixing block 9 is mounted at the side of the support 4 through screws, a screw tube 11 is mounted at the side of the first fixing block 9 through screws, a lead screw 10 is mounted at the internal thread of the screw tube 11, a second connecting plate 19 is mounted at the top end of the lead screw 10 through a movable mechanism, the first connecting plate 16 is mounted at the side of the second mounting plate 3 through screws, the first connecting plate 16 corresponds to the second connecting plate 19 in position, a fixing shaft 17 penetrates through the surfaces of the second connecting plate 19 and the first connecting plate 16, so that the two fixing shafts 17 rotate along the inner walls of the second connecting plate 19 and the first connecting plate 16, respectively, and a connecting rod 18 is installed between one ends of the two fixing shafts 17 by means of a screw. The movable mechanism includes a second fixed block 22 and a plurality of limiting members 20, the second fixed block 22 is mounted at the end of the screw rod 10 through a screw, the plurality of limiting members 20 are mounted at the side of the second connecting plate 19 through a screw, a sliding groove 21 is formed in the side of the second fixed block 22, and one end of each of the plurality of limiting members 20 extends into the sliding groove 21, so that one end of each of the limiting members 20 slides along the inner wall of the sliding groove 21. The limiting members 20 are concave, and at least two limiting members 20 are symmetrically arranged. When adjusting the angle of the second mounting plate, firstly rotating the lead screw 10, the lead screw 10 rotates in the internal thread of the screw tube 11, the lead screw 10 drives the second fixing block 22 to move synchronously, the inner wall of the sliding groove 21 slides along one end surface of the limiting member 20, so that the lead screw 10 drives the second connecting plate 19 to move synchronously in the vertical direction, the second connecting plate 19 drives the connecting rod 18 to move in the vertical direction through the fixing shaft 17, during the moving process of the connecting rod 18, the connecting rod 18 rotates on the inner wall of the second connecting plate 19 through the fixing shaft 17, for adjusting the angle between the connecting rod 18 and the second connecting plate 19, so as to drive the connecting rod 18 to rotate in the inner wall of the first connecting plate 16 through the fixing shaft 17, so that the connecting rod 18 drives the first connecting plate 16 to move synchronously, and the first connecting plate 16 drives the second mounting plate 3 to rotate in the inner walls of the two second fixing plates 14 through the two, the angle adjustment of the second mounting plate 3 is facilitated.
The surface of the second mounting plate 3 is provided with the movable plate 2 through a positioning mechanism, the positioning mechanism comprises a long-strip concave part 7 and a first fixing plate 13, the long-strip concave part 7 is arranged on the side surface of the movable plate 2 through a screw, the first fixing plate 13 is arranged on the top of the second mounting plate 3 through a screw, the first fixing plate 13 corresponds to the long-strip concave part 7 in position, the surface of the long-strip concave part 7 is at least provided with eight second screw holes 8 which are arranged at equal intervals, the side surface of the first fixing plate 13 is provided with a first screw hole 12, a stud 6 is arranged in the first screw hole 12 in a threaded manner, one end of the stud 6 extends into the second screw hole 8, if the distance between the second mounting plate 3 and the cloth discharging device is long, the stud 6 needs to be rotated firstly, the internal thread 6 rotates in the first screw hole 12, when the stud 6 is taken out from the second screw hole, can exert the effort to fly leaf 2, make fly leaf 2 slide along the both sides face of second mounting panel 3, a length for adjusting between second mounting panel 3 and the fly leaf 2, adjust at fly leaf 2 and accomplish the back, can reverse rotation double-screw bolt 6, double-screw bolt 6 rotates at 12 internal threads of first screw, a inside at second screw 8 is installed to drive 6 screw threads of double-screw bolt, and then play spacing effect to rectangular concave part 7, the stability of length between fly leaf 2 and the second mounting panel 3 has been improved, make things convenient for this stoving auxiliary assembly to carry out suitable regulation.
In the working process of the device, the cloth drops on the surface of the movable plate 2 from a cloth outlet of the cloth discharging device and sequentially slides to the inside of the cloth hopper 5 along the surfaces of the movable plate 2 and the second mounting plate 3, the first mounting plate 1 corresponds to the cloth receiving device, and a feeding roller of the cloth receiving device is positioned on one side of the first mounting plate 1, so that after the cloth drops in the cloth hopper 5, the surface of the cloth is in contact with the surface of the feeding roller, the feeding roller is driven by electric shock to rotate, the feeding roller drives the cloth to be conveyed to the drying device, the cloth is always in a loose tension-free state in the drying process, and the quality of the cloth is improved.
